Questions about the credits
- Who wrote Dance To South Pacific by Les Brown And His Band Of Renown?
- The writing on Dance To South Pacific by Les Brown And His Band Of Renown is credited to Oscar Hammerstein II and Richard Rodgers.
- Who arranged and orchestrated Dance To South Pacific by Les Brown And His Band Of Renown?
- Dance To South Pacific by Les Brown And His Band Of Renown was arranged by J. Hill, Don Bagley, Les Brown, Sonny Burke, Frank Comstock, Billy May, and Wes Hensel.
